Ahhhh! I eventually arrived in Yiwu, an industrial city in Zhiejiang, China. I spent five hours waiting at the Shenzhen airport due to some not understandable reasons. I thought China Southern Airline is the best airline of China but it seems not quite at all. If my trip was related to personal holidays, then I wouldn’t mind waiting as I could have plenty of time but my trip was related to work then the schedule was very tight. It’s only one flight a day, and three flights a week flying from Shenzhen aiprort to Yiwu in the whole canton area. It’s the reason why I was so nervous if the flight was cancelled completely. The next flight will be on Friday then I need to travel back to HK from Shenzhen by boat again. It would be extremely troublesome and inconvenience. The public announcement of flight details was totally unclear at the airport. They announced two different departure time in two different languages. They announced the flight would be delayed to 4:50pm in Mandarin, then announced again 7:00pm in English. Such announcement was repeated again and again. When I asked the airline people to confirm the details, they just can’t give me any answers. However, I am very glad I eventually arrived though it was five hours delay.

I just found out that domestic flight is always delayed as the local people around me who took it casually. They didn’t react like the way I did. There must be lots of complains if such case happened in HK. They only offered us a bottle of water in five hours which couldn’t be happened in HK. Airlines in HK must offer free lunch for five hours delay in terms of compensation. Well, anyway I sincerely hope that there is no delay on Friday flight as the local airport is extremely small. There is not much space for sitting. If the weather changed to too cold, then it would be horrible to wait at the airport as this airport is very much in outdoor.
